​Novo Nordisk and AWS Partner to Accelerate Drug Discovery via AI Co-Innovation Hub in London

Novo Nordisk and Amazon Web Services (AWS)  announced a strategic partnership to accelerate drug discovery and modernize Novo Nordisk’s technology infrastructure using agentic AI and cloud computing. 

The agreement establishes AWS as Novo Nordisk’s preferred cloud provider and strategic AI partner, bringing together deep therapeutic expertise in chronic diseases with world-leading cloud infrastructure and life sciences tools. As part of the collaboration, the companies have created a dedicated AI co-innovation hub at Novo Nordisk’s London facility, co-locating AWS engineers, AI specialists, and applied scientists with Novo Nordisk R&D teams to compress the timeline from drug target identification to the first human dose.  

​The partnership utilizes advanced cloud and AI services, such as Amazon Bio Discovery and Amazon Bedrock, to identify drug targets, design therapies faster, and integrate genomic, imaging, and clinical datasets to optimize clinical trial design. Novo Nordisk will also leverage Amazon Bedrock AgentCore to streamline enterprise operations through autonomous AI agents.

Building on an existing relationship that has already reduced clinical documentation time and boosted productivity for over 25,000 employees, Novo Nordisk is additionally collaborating across broader Amazon health platforms including Amazon Pharmacy, Amazon Ads, and Amazon One Medical to transform how new therapies are marketed and delivered to patients globally.
